  • Jarrett Guarantano: Let go by Denver

    Guarantano was waived by the Broncos on Tuesday, Aaron Wilson of KPRC 2 Houston reports. Guarantano will head to waivers after spending last season bouncing between Denver's practice squad and active roster. The 2022 undrafted free agent has yet to play a snap in a regular-season game and will now look to catch on with another team.

  • Broncos' Jarrett Guarantano: Added to Denver's roster

    The Broncos will sign Guarantano to the 53-man roster from their practice squad Tuesday, Brandon Krisztal of KOA 850 AM Denver reports. Guarantano looks set to stick on Denver's roster for the final three games of the season, though he'll slide to third on the depth chart behind Russell Wilson and Brett Rypien as soon as Wilson clears the NFL's concussion protocol. While Wilson was sidelined for this past Sunday's 24-15 win over the Cardinals, Guarantano served as the backup to Rypien before reverting to the practice squad following the game. Wilson could be ready to go for Sunday's game against the Rams, but because the Cardinals were entertaining the idea of adding Guarantano to their roster as insurance at the position while their top quarterback (Colt McCoy) also finds himself in the concussion protocol, Denver swooped in to sign Guarantano before Arizona could.

  • Jarrett Guarantano: Back to practice squad Monday

    Guarantano reverted to the Broncos' practice squad Monday. Guarantano was elevated from the practice squad to serve as the team's No. 2 quarterback behind Brett Rypien, who started in place of Russell Wilson (concussion) for the second game in a row Sunday. However, Rypien went on to play every offensive snap, completing 21 of his 26 passes for 197 yards and one touchdown to one interception in this win over Arizona. Guarantano will now be eligible for one more elevation from the practice squad, though it's unlikely this will happen if Wilson returns against the Rams on Christmas Day.

  • Broncos' Jarrett Guarantano: Will be available vs. Arizona

    Denver elevated Guarantano from its practice squad to the active roster Saturday ahead of Sunday's game versus the Cardinals, Ben Swanson of the Broncos' official site reports. Less than two weeks after signing with the team, Guarantano will be called on to serve as the backup quarterback with Russell Wilson (concussion) out. The rookie from Washington State has yet to play a regular-season NFL snap.

  • Cardinals' Jarrett Guarantano: In line to play in preseason opener

    Guarantano is in line to log QB reps behind Trace McSorley during Friday's preseason game against the Bengals, Darren Urban of the team's official site reports. With both Kyler Murray (wrist) and Colt McCoy (arm) in line to rest against the Bengals Friday, Guarantano is slated to work behind Trace McSorley in what should be a critical game for the two, as they compete for a roster spot behind Murray and McCoy.
